انجمن


مشکل فوری در قسمت نظرات سایت / حذف نشدن ایمیل و نام  (۷ نوشته)

  • NiMa.N

    آفلاین
    عضو
    تعداد نوشته‌ها: ۱۵۷
    تشکر شده: ۲۹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۱:۵۸

    سلام
    چند وقته به یک مشکل خیلی جدی توی بخش نظرات سایتم مواجه شدم
    مشکل اینجاست که کسی که با نام و ایمیل نظر میده توی فیلد مربوطه ، نام و ایمیل نویسنده نظر میمونه و پاک نمیشه و اگر کسی با یک سیستم دیگر وارد همون بخش نظرات بشه نام و ایمیل نویسنده نظر قبلی رو میبنه و باید اونارو از توی فیلدها پاک کنه تا بتونه نام و ایمیل خودشو وارد کنه برای نظر.
    برای تمام نظراتم به همین صورت هست. چند بار فایلهای وردپرس رو پاک کردم و دوباره جایگزین کردم ولی متاسفانه درست نشد. به نظرتون چیکار کنم؟ سپاس

  • NESTED

    آفلاین
    عضو فعال
    تعداد نوشته‌ها: ۲۳۵۴
    تشکر شده: ۲۳۷۰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۲:۲۸

    شما از روی سیستم خودتون چک کردین
    یا از سیستم دیگه ایی هم چک کردین
    منظورم رایانه دیگه ایی هست

    کاربران زیر به‌خاطر این نوشته تشکر کرده‌اند:
    NiMa.N
  • NiMa.N

    آفلاین
    عضو
    تعداد نوشته‌ها: ۱۵۷
    تشکر شده: ۲۹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۳:۱۷

    این مشکل رو نزدیک به 30 نفر اعلام کردن و خودم هم که چک کردم به همین صورت بود متاسفانه.

  • NiMa.N

    آفلاین
    عضو
    تعداد نوشته‌ها: ۱۵۷
    تشکر شده: ۲۹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۳:۲۲

    ببینید به این صورت هست که مثلا" یکی از بازدیدکنندگان میاد میگه توی قسمت فیلد نام و ایمیل ، وقتی که وارد میشه نام و ایمیل کس دیگری ثبت شده و باید اونارو پاک کنه تا بتونه نام و ایمیل خودشونو وارد کنه. برای خودم هم چندین بار توی سایتم اتفاق افتاده .

  • NESTED

    آفلاین
    عضو فعال
    تعداد نوشته‌ها: ۲۳۵۴
    تشکر شده: ۲۳۷۰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۳:۳۳

    فایل کامنت پوستتون رو تغییر اسم بدین
    و بعد بررسی کنید

    کاربران زیر به‌خاطر این نوشته تشکر کرده‌اند:
    NiMa.N
  • NiMa.N

    آفلاین
    عضو
    تعداد نوشته‌ها: ۱۵۷
    تشکر شده: ۲۹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۳:۵۴

    ممنون از شما
    ولی متاسفانه مشکل هنوز پابرجاست
    الان خودم که وارد میشم یکبار قسمت نظرات بدون اینکه فیلد ها پر باشه میاد باز دوباره که وارد میشم به عنوان مدیر سایت وارد میشه

  • NiMa.N

    آفلاین
    عضو
    تعداد نوشته‌ها: ۱۵۷
    تشکر شده: ۲۹ بار
    # نوشته شده: ۷ سال پیش
    ۱۹ اسفند ۱۳۹۰ - ۱۴:۰۰

    البته شاید هم از فایل کامن باشه . براتون میزارم ممنون میشم چکش کنید:

    <style>
    .comment-childs { padding-top:10px;}
    .comment-childs img  { float:left;}
    .comment-childs div { background:#EDFAEB !important; padding:10px; border:1px solid #ccc; margin-top:10px; }
    .comment-childs p { padding:0px; }
    </style>
    <h3><a href="<?php the_permalink(); ?>#respond" title="ارسال نظر">ارسال نظر - كليك كنيد</a></h3>
    
    <?php // Do not delete these lines
    if ('comments.php' == basename($_SERVER['SCRIPT_FILENAME']))
    die (__('Please do not load this page directly. Thanks!','mimbo'));
    if (!empty($post->post_password)) { // if there's a password
    if ($_COOKIE['wp-postpass_' . COOKIEHASH] != $post->post_password) {  // and it doesn't match the cookie
    ?>
    <div class="nocomments">
      <?php __('این خبر محافظت شده می باشد . حتی برای ارسال نظر هم باید کلمه عبور را وارد کنید','mimbo'); ?>
    </div>
    <?php
    return;
    }
    }
    $oddcomment = 'class="alt"';
    ?>
    <?php if ($comments) : ?>
    <div class="cblock">
      <ol class="commentlist">
    
        <?php $i=0; foreach ($comments as $comment) : $i++; ?>
        <li style="border:1px solid #eee; padding:10px; margin-bottom:10px; <?php if($i%2){ ?>background:#eee;<?php } else { ?>background:#fff;<?php } ?>" class="border-radius comment-container
        <?php
            $authID=get_the_author_meta('ID');
            if($authID == $comment->user_id)
                $oddcomment = 'authcomment';
            echo $oddcomment;
        ?>"  id="comment-<?php comment_ID(); ?>">
     <small class="commentmetadata">
        <b> ارسالی از :
          <?php comment_author_link() ?>
          <?php __('on','mimbo');?>
          - در تاریخ :
          <?php comment_date('j F Y') ?>
          </b> </small>
          <?php if ($comment->comment_approved == '0') : ?>
          <em>
          <?php _e('نظر شما ثبت شد ، در انتظار تایید پشتیبان.','mimbo'); ?>
          </em>
          <?php comment_reply_link( $args, $comment, $post ); ?>
          <?php endif; ?>
          <?php comment_text(); ?>
        </li>
        <?php
    /* Changes every other comment to a different class */
    $oddcomment = ( empty( $oddcomment ) ) ? 'class="alt" ' : '';
    ?>
        <?php endforeach; /* end for each comment */ ?>
      </ol>
    </div>
    <?php else : // this is displayed if there are no comments so far ?>
    <?php if ('open' == $post->comment_status) : ?>
    <?php else : // comments are closed ?>
    <p class="nocomments">
      <?php _e('امکان نظر دادن نیست - نظرات توسط پشتیبان غیر فعال می باشد','mimbo'); ?>
    </p>
    <?php endif; ?>
    <?php endif; ?>
    <?php if ('open' == $post->comment_status) : ?>
    <a name="respond"></a>
    <a href="#top"> <img src="http://pnuna.com/wp-content/themes/PNUNA/images/go-up.gif" align="center" width="89" height="18" alt"goup" title="goup" /> </a>
    <div class="border-radius" style="border:1px solid #ccc; background:#e4f8ff; padding:10px; line-height:16px;text-align:justify;">
    - نظراتی که به پیشرفت و تعمیق بحث کمک می کنند در مدت کوتاهی پس از دریافت به نظر دیگر بینندگان می رسد.<br />
      - نظرات حاوی الفاظ سبک یا هرگونه توهین، افترا، کنایه یا تحقیر نسبت به دیگران منعکس نمی ‏شوند. <br />
      - از نوشتن دیدگاهایتان با حروف فینگلیش جدا" خودداری کنید. <br />
      - پاسخ های پشتیبان های سایت به رنگ سبز نمایش داده می شود. مسئولیت نظرات دیگران بر عهده ما نمی باشد.
    <!-- <br />
    <span style="color: #ff0000;"> - نظرات به صورت صفحه بندی شده است . جديدترين نظرات در صفحات آخر ثبت مي شود </span> -->
    </div>
    
    <?php //_e('نظر بدهید','mimbo'); ?>
    <?php if ( get_option('comment_registration') && !$user_ID ) : ?>
    
    <?php else : ?>
    <form action="<?php echo get_option('siteurl'); ?>/wp-comments-post.php" method="post" id="commentform">
      <?php if ( $user_ID ) : ?>
      <p>
        <?php _e('وارد شده با','mimbo'); ?>
        <a href="<?php echo get_option('siteurl'); ?>/wp-admin/profile.php"><?php echo $user_identity; ?></a>. <a href="<?php echo get_option('siteurl'); ?>/wp-login.php?action=logout" title="<?php _e('Log out of this account','mimbo'); ?>">
        <?php _e('خارج شوید &raquo;','mimbo'); ?>
        </a>
      </p>
      <?php else : ?>
      <table cellpadding="2" cellspacing="2">
        <tr>
          <td style="padding-bottom:5px; width:70px;"><label for="name">نام:</label></td>
          <td style="padding-bottom:5px"><input type="text" name="author" id="author" value="<?php echo $comment_author; ?>" size="32" tabindex="1" /></td>
        </tr>
        <tr>
          <td style="padding-bottom:5px"><label for="email">ايميل:</label></td>
          <td style="padding-bottom:5px"><input type="text" name="email" id="email" value="<?php echo $comment_author_email; ?>" size="32" tabindex="2" /></td>
        </tr>
        <tr>
          <td style="padding-bottom:5px"><label for="url">وب سايت : </label></td>
          <td style="padding-bottom:5px"><input type="text" name="url" id="url" value="<?php echo $comment_author_url; ?>" size="32" tabindex="3" /></td>
        </tr>
      </table>
      <?php endif; ?>
      <p>
        <textarea name="comment"  id="comment"  cols="50" rows="10" tabindex="4"></textarea>
      </p>
      <p>
        <input name="submit" class="button" type="submit" id="submit" tabindex="5" value="<?php _e('ارسال نظر','mimbo'); ?>" />
        <input type="hidden" name="comment_post_ID" value="<?php echo $id; ?>" />
      </p>
      <?php do_action('comment_form', $post->ID); ?>
    </form>
    <?php endif; // If registration required and not logged in ?>
    <?php endif; // if you delete this the sky will fall on your head ?>

    سپاس از شما

درباره‌ی این موضوع



برچسب‌ها